We’re partnering with district leaders to build tools that support instructional coherence

In today’s fragmented edtech landscape, schools are often left stitching together tools that don’t always align with curriculum, instruction, and student needs. As AI expands the possibilities to better support students and teachers, it also introduces complexity when products aren’t connected or grounded in pedagogy. By collaborating early and often with educators through our pilots, we’re working to ensure that the evolution of edtech reflects real classroom priorities, aligns supplemental products to core curriculum, and enables instructional interoperability across tools.

Curriculum Sync

Load & customize curriculum into your LMS

Bring high-quality curriculum into your existing Learning Management System.

Curriculum Sync offers free and seamless curriculum integration

Illustration of a green book and an analytics dashboard connected by curved arrows, symbolizing the symbiotic relationship between education and technology.

Support district curriculum needs

Eliminates the need for contractors and manual uploads. Districts can quickly load and customize curriculum directly into their LMS.

Illustration of a central analytics dashboard with a line graph and settings icon, connected by arrows to three smaller interface windows, representing system integration.

Fully LMS-native

Enables interoperability without relying on third-party platforms or custom integrations, reducing IT burden and making curriculum delivery faster and more consistent.

Isometric illustration of a key floating above a bar graph on a grid, symbolizing data access and ownership

District data ownership

Provides admin visibility, reporting features to support decision making, and feedback loops to better integrate district customization.
